Whoever created this tipping calculation is about to get their math privileges revoked! The sign starts with a noble cause—encouraging proper tipping—but then descends into numerical chaos. Moving the decimal point is correct (10%), but somehow multiplying by 3 gives us $32.75 (30%), and then the final total magically becomes $139.75?! That's a 130% tip! Either this restaurant employs calculus wizards who deserve Nobel Prizes, or someone failed elementary arithmetic. Next time you're calculating a tip, remember: percentages aren't supposed to bend the fabric of mathematical reality.
